Responsibilities
- Provide high-level administrative and operational support to executive leadership in a mission-driven nonprofit organization
- Manage complex calendars schedule meetings and coordinate logistics across internal teams
- Prepare edit and format executive-level documents reports presentations and briefing materials
- Track action items deadlines and follow-ups to support effective decision-making and accountability
- Assist with administrative tasks such as invoice tracking expense documentation and vendor coordination as assigned
- Maintain well-organized digital files and records ensuring confidentiality and compliance with organizational policies
- Anticipate needs proactively identify issues and recommend process improvements to support executive efficiency
Qualifications :
- Proven experience providing executive-level administrative support preferably within a nonprofit or mission-driven organization
- Strong understanding of professionalism confidentiality and discretion when working with senior leadership
- Exceptional organizational skills and attention to detail with the ability to manage competing priorities independently
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to draft polished executive correspondence
- Proficiency with remote work tools Microsoft Office Suite Zoom and project/task management platforms
- Comfortable working part-time in a remote environment and communicating effectively across time zones
- Self-directed dependable and proactive with strong judgment and problem-solving skills
- Alignment with nonprofit values and a commitment to supporting organizational mission and impact
Equipment Requirements:
As a consultant-level virtual assistant candidates must provide their own professional-grade equipment including a reliable computer with sufficient processing power to support multitasking (minimum 16 GB RAM and SSD storage) high-speed internet with a backup connection and a private secure workspace. A high-quality webcam microphone and adequate lighting are required for client-facing meetings. Candidates must also use secure systems including a VPN password manager and multi-factor authentication to protect confidential client information.
Additional Information :
Salary Information: The salary range for this position is $25.00 to $30.00 per hour depending on experience. This is contract work @ 20 hours per week. Fully remote highly prefer Eastern time zone.
